When used in a historical context, "British" or "Britons" can refer to the Celtic Britons , the indigenous inhabitants of Great Britain and Brittany , whose surviving members are the modern Welsh people , Cornish people , and Bretons. Though early assertions of being British date from the Late Middle Ages , the Union of the Crowns in and the creation of the Kingdom of Great Britain [38] [39] [40] [41] [42] in triggered a sense of British national identity. Modern Britons are descended mainly from the varied ethnic groups that settled in Great Britain in and before the 11th century: Prehistoric , Brittonic, Roman , Anglo-Saxon , Norse , and Normans. The British are a diverse, multinational , [52] [53] multicultural and multilingual society, with "strong regional accents, expressions and identities".

A woman is an adult female human. The plural women is sometimes used for female humans regardless of age, as in phrases such as " women's rights. Typically, a woman has two X chromosomes and is capable of pregnancy and giving birth from puberty until menopause. Female anatomy, as distinguished from male anatomy, includes the fallopian tubes , ovaries , uterus , vulva , breasts , Skene's glands , and Bartholin's glands. The adult female pelvis is wider than the male's, the hips are generally broader, and women have significantly less facial and other body hair. On average, women are shorter and less muscular than men. Throughout human history , traditional gender roles have often defined and limited women's activities and opportunities; many religious doctrines stipulate certain rules for women.
